Vela Systems Completes $10.5M Funding

Eric Hal Schwartz 7/28/09

Burlington, MA-based Vela Systems, which develops software for construction firms, has completed a $10.5 million equity funding, according to an amended SEC filing made today. The investors were not disclosed. In July 2007, Vela raised $6 million, which is included in the $10.5 million total. The company provides software to allow construction companies to access, modify, and manage paperwork using mobile devices. Vela was spun out of mobile software research and development from the MIT Center for Real Estate and the Harvard Graduate School of Design. [A previous version of this story mistakenly implied that Vela had raised $10.5 million in new funding. We regret the error---Eds.]
